# Simplified Homeserver Setup
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
Full instructions are located around here: https://matrix-org.github.io/synapse/v1.37/setup/installation.html
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
These instructions are for a quick setup you can use for local development of OOYE, if you don't have administrator access to an existing homeserver.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Windows prerequisites
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
Enter an Ubuntu WSL. LOL
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Install Synapse
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
We'll install from the prebuilt packages provided by matrix.org. If you're not on Debian/Ubuntu then you can find more package names [in the official docs.](https://matrix-org.github.io/synapse/v1.37/setup/installation.html#prebuilt-packages)
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
```
 | 
			
		||||
sudo apt install -y lsb-release wget apt-transport-https
 | 
			
		||||
sudo wget -O /usr/share/keyrings/matrix-org-archive-keyring.gpg https://packages.matrix.org/debian/matrix-org-archive-keyring.gpg
 | 
			
		||||
echo "deb [signed-by=/usr/share/keyrings/matrix-org-archive-keyring.gpg] https://packages.matrix.org/debian/ $(lsb_release -cs) main" | sudo tee /etc/apt/sources.list.d/matrix-org.list
 | 
			
		||||
sudo apt update
 | 
			
		||||
sudo apt install matrix-synapse-py3
 | 
			
		||||
```
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
After the final command finishes downloading, it will interactively prompt you for the homeserver's name for federation. Just enter `localhost`.
 | 
			
		||||
If you want to change this later, you can do so with `sudo dpkg-reconfigure matrix-synapse-py3`.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Not installing additional features
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
We're going to stick with SQLite, which isn't as efficient as Postgres, but significantly eases setup. For this small test, SQLite should do just fine.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
We don't need TLS certificates for localhost.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Start it on Linux
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
```
 | 
			
		||||
sudo systemctl start matrix-synapse
 | 
			
		||||
```
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Start it on Windows
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
Trying to start it with systemctl doesn't seem to like me, so I'll do it this way:
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
```
 | 
			
		||||
sudo /opt/venvs/matrix-synapse/bin/python -m synapse.app.homeserver --config-path=/etc/matrix-synapse/homeserver.yaml --config-path=/etc/matrix-synapse/conf.d/ --generate-keys
 | 
			
		||||
sudo /opt/venvs/matrix-synapse/bin/python -m synapse.app.homeserver --config-path=/etc/matrix-synapse/homeserver.yaml --config-path=/etc/matrix-synapse/conf.d/
 | 
			
		||||
```
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Notes
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
If you see `Config is missing macaroon_secret_key`, you can ignore this. The real log messages are in `/var/log/matrix-synapse/*.log`.
